How much do entry level project management j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level project management in the United States is $23.43,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.03 and $27.40 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level project manager?

An entry level project manager is a professional who assists in planning, executing, and closing projects under the supervision of more experienced managers. They typically help coordinate tasks, communicate with team members, track project progress, and ensure deadlines are met. Entry level project managers often work on smaller projects or specific aspects of larger projects, gaining experience and developing their skills for more advanced roles. Strong organizational and communication skills are important in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level project manager?

To thrive as an Entry Level Project Manager, you need fundamental knowledge of project management principles, organizational abilities, and typically a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Microsoft Project, Trello, or Asana and basic understanding of methodologies such as Agile or Waterfall are often required, and a CAPM certification can be beneficial. Strong communication, teamwork, and problem-solving skills help you coordinate stakeholders and manage project tasks effectively.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ering projects on time, within scope, and building the foundation for further career growth.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level project managers, and how can they overcome them?

Entry-level project managers often face challenges such as managing competing priorities, adapting to new team dynamics, and understanding project management tools and methodologies. To overcome these hurdles, it is helpful to maintain clear communication with team members, seek mentorship from experienced colleagues, and invest time in learning project management software. Being proactive in asking questions and clarifying expectations can also help new project managers build confidence and contribute effectively to projects.

What is the difference between Entry Level Project Management vs Project Coordinator?

AspectEntry Level Project ManagementProject Coordinator
CredentialsTypically a bachelor's degree; certifications like CAPM are a plusUsually a bachelor's degree; certifications are optional
Work EnvironmentInvolves planning, scheduling, and overseeing projectsSupports project teams, manages documentation, and tracks progress
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ries for entry-level roles in project teamsCommonly found in various industries supporting project execution

Entry Level Project Management focuses on planning and overseeing projects, often requiring some certifications and a broader scope of responsibilities. Project Coordinators primarily support project teams with administrative tasks and tracking. While both roles are entry-level and share similar environments, Project Management roles involve more strategic planning, whereas Coordinators focus on execution support.

Can you get an entry level project management job with no experience?

Entry level project management roles often require some related skills such as organization, communication, and familiarity with project management tools like MS Project or Trello. While prior experience is not always mandatory, obtaining certifications like CAPM or PMP can improve chances and demonstrate knowledge of project management principles.

How to get into entry level project management as a beginner?

To start an entry level project management role, gain relevant skills such as organization, communication, and basic knowledge of project management tools like Microsoft Project or Trello. Obtain certifications like Certified Associate in Project Management (CAPM) or pursue a related bachelor's degree to improve your qualifications. Gaining experience through internships or volunteering can also help build practical skills and demonstrate your interest in the field.
